From 676d2e28de1c335448d1c1a997371b011f9630e2 Mon Sep 17 00:00:00 2001 From: Mihai Iorga Date: Tue, 19 Jul 2016 02:39:28 +0300 Subject: [PATCH] pushStatusHandler wrong payload md5, PushController send pushId to adapter also (#2067) --- src/Controllers/PushController.js | 4 ++-- src/pushStatusHandler.js |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/Controllers/PushController.js b/src/Controllers/PushController.js index 954fdfef..6827e770 100644 --- a/src/Controllers/PushController.js +++ b/src/Controllers/PushController.js @@ -124,11 +124,11 @@ export class PushController extends AdaptableController { } else { payload.data.badge = parseInt(badge); } - return this.adapter.send(payload, badgeInstallationsMap[badge]); + return this.adapter.send(payload, badgeInstallationsMap[badge], pushStatus.objectId); }); return Promise.all(promises); } - return this.adapter.send(body, installations); + return this.adapter.send(body, installations, pushStatus.objectId); } /** diff --git a/src/pushStatusHandler.js b/src/pushStatusHandler.js index 0429f4d1..3bed8cfa 100644 --- a/src/pushStatusHandler.js +++ b/src/pushStatusHandler.js @@ -36,7 +36,7 @@ export default function pushStatusHandler(config) { expiry: body.expiration_time, status: "pending", numSent: 0, - pushHash: md5Hash(payloadString), + pushHash: md5Hash(data.alert || ''), // lockdown! ACL: {} }